Check out today's current affairs
1.Which department has been brought under the Finance Ministry?- Department of Public Enterprises.
2.What is the second-tallest building worldwide?- Shanghai Tower.
3.Which country has decided to ban construction of tallest skyscrapers taller than 500m?- China.
4.Which state government has proposed to have its own OTT platform?- Kerala.
5.In which forest Gravely boro spider species have been found in India?- Chirang Reserve Forest of Assam.
6.By which percentage crime against women has increased in the capital, data released by Delhi Police?- 63.3%.
7.Which interface has been launched by Mastercard in collaboration with Payments solution provider Razorpay?- MandateHQ.
8.What is the name of the Indian Naval Ship that has participated in military exercises with Italian Navy?- Tabar.
9.Which greenhouse gas level has increased by 125 per cent in Delhi during the period of last one year?- NO2.
10.Where is the World's tallest sandcastle located?- Denmark.
11.Which companies have been fined by the Chinese government to tighten control over their fast-developing industries?- Alibaba & Tencent.
12.What is USA's ranking in NewsOnAir Radio Live-stream Global Rankings?- 1st.
13.When was AIR established?-1936.
14.What is the name of GI certified wheat that has been exported to Kenya and Sri Lanka from Gujarat?- Bhalia.
15.What is the name of the former Himachal Pradesh CM & Union Minister who died at the age of 87?- Virbhadra Singh.
